Transaction 87045145360f529fd0a2b2663c3bd8d20378cb42a62b152291f181f2d33a5207

block
f88ee28324ce8825e19adc56a4d43f6a2ffe43a15d2e918e894445f253f67d3f

1 Input

24 Outputs